Nuclear factor erythroid 2-related factor 2 ameliorates disordered glucose and lipid metabolism in liver: Involvement of gasdermin D in regulating pyroptosis
•MAFLD is associated with increased hepatocytes NRF2 expression. | |
•NRF2 alleviates MAFLD by suppressing pyroptosis. | |
•NRF2 directly inhibits GSDMD expression to regulate pyroptosis. | |
•Targeting the NRF2–pyroptosis (GSDMD) axis offers a potential therapeutic strategy for MAFLD. |
